1. Disconnect the wire from the negative terminal of the battery.

2. Remove the screw securing the upholstery in the front door armrest.

3. Using a screwdriver, remove the decorative trim from the inner door lock handle.
Helpful Hint: To avoid scratching the parts, wrap the tip of the screwdriver with electrical tape.

4. Under the trim, unscrew the door trim fastening screw.

5. Overcoming the force of the plastic clips, carefully separate the trim from the front door panel.

6. Disconnect the wiring harness connector from the power window control unit and the wiring harness connector from the exterior mirror control unit installed in the trim.

7. Disconnect the cable from the inner handle lever and remove the trim.

Note: Upholstery (view from the back side) attached to the door panel with eight plastic pins.
Replace damaged pins with new ones by removing them from the trim brackets.

8. Remove the two screws securing the armrest bracket to the door panel...

9. ...and remove the bracket.

10. Remove the corner decorative cover by overcoming the elastic resistance of the two clamps

11. Move the wiring harness connector lock towards you...

12. ...and disconnect the connector from the rearview mirror connector.

13. Peel off the moisture-proof film from the door panel and remove it, threading the rear-view mirror wiring harness through the hole in the film.
14. Install the front door trim and all removed parts in the reverse order of removal.
